THE PURPOSE OF THE SOCIETY IS TO PROMOTE THE COMMON PROFESSIONAL INTERESTS OF OBSTETRICIANS AND GYNECOLOGISTS IN NORTH CAROLINA IN ORDER TO FOSTER AND STIMULATE IMPROVEMENTS IN ALL ASPECTS OF THE HEALTH CARE OF WOMEN WHICH PROPERLY COMES WITHIN THE SCOPE OF OBSTETRICS AND GYNECOLOGY.

Common questions about NORTH CAROLINA OBSTETRICAL AND GYNECOLOGICAL SOCIETY
What does the Chief Executive Officer of NORTH CAROLINA OBSTETRICAL AND GYNECOLOGICAL SOCIETY earn?
In 2023, the Chief Executive Officer of NORTH CAROLINA OBSTETRICAL AND GYNECOLOGICAL SOCIETY received $10,563 in total compensation. This pay is in the bottom 10% for Chief Executive Officer roles among nonprofits nationwide, across all sectors: at least 9 in 10 comparable filings report more. Based on IRS Form 990 data.
How does Chief Executive Officer pay at NORTH CAROLINA OBSTETRICAL AND GYNECOLOGICAL SOCIETY compare with similar nonprofits?
Compared with the same role at nonprofits nationwide, across all sectors, the 2023 pay of the Chief Executive Officer at NORTH CAROLINA OBSTETRICAL AND GYNECOLOGICAL SOCIETY falls in the bottom 10%.
What are NORTH CAROLINA OBSTETRICAL AND GYNECOLOGICAL SOCIETY's revenue and expenses?
In 2023, NORTH CAROLINA OBSTETRICAL AND GYNECOLOGICAL SOCIETY reported $246k in total revenue and $225k in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
